My Approach
I work with adults who in some way, find themselves stuck. That may be due to a current life circumstance, but it could also be though repeating behaviours or thoughts that are damaging, don't seem to make any sense or are no long useful. Sometimes just having the space to express what you're going through with someone who is on your side, and whose only agenda is your well being, can be enough bring about a shift. I see my role as that of a companion, standing shoulder to shoulder with you whilst we look at the aspects of your life that are causing you concern or distress.
